Problem 1: “Lagony” – Frustratingly Slow Computers

When your computer responds sluggishly, or applications take a while to load, it’s not just a mere annoyance; it’s a drain on employee productivity. These problems with IT are typically tied to either hardware or software issues.

Solution: Speed Up Your Systems

To resolve slow performance, start by cleaning up your hard drive. Delete unneeded files, limit startup programs, and defragment your disk. Consider upgrading your hardware or moving towards a cloud service, which can provide scalable resources to meet your needs.

Problem 2: Network Connectivity

The Challenge of Staying Connected

Losing internet access is a critical technology issue in business today. From a simple router reboot to a major power outage, network connectivity issues can disrupt your access to data, significantly diminishing your operational efficiency.

 

Ensuring Constant Connectivity

First, perform basic checks: Is your Wi-Fi turned on? Are all cables properly connected? If the problems persist, consider leveraging managed services that provide round-the-clock network monitoring and rapid issue resolution.

 

Problem 3: Data Security Threats

The Risk of Vulnerability

Data breaches pose a significant security risk, especially for small businesses. A 2022 report by IBM found that the global average cost of a data breach was $4.35 million, a figure that can be catastrophic for many businesses.

 

Solution: Fortifying Your Defenses

Invest in robust security software and educate your team about safe online practices. Keep your systems updated, and consider hiring managed services to handle your security needs professionally.

 

Problem 4: Data Backup and Recovery Issues

The Dangers of Lost Data

Data backup is often overlooked until disaster strikes. From accidental deletions to system failures, data loss is a serious IT problem in business. Research shows that 40% of data loss is caused by hardware failure, while human error ranks second at 29%.

 

Solution: Implementing a Reliable Backup Plan

Regularly backup data, both onsite and offsite, and test your backups frequently. Cloud-based backup services can offer automated and secure options for data storage and recovery.
